Elon Musk offers to buy Twitter for $41.4bn

Tech entrepreneur makes offer of $54.20 a share in cash for microblogging site

The tech billionaire Elon Musk has offered to buy Twitter for $41.4bn.

A regulatory filing showed on Thursday that Musk was offering $54.20 a share – a 38% premium to the closing price of Twitter’s stock on 1 April, the last trading day before the Tesla chief executive’s investment of more than 9% in the company was publicly announced.
